Job Description
The Opportunity

The energy transition demands engineering that operates at the frontier — and this role sits right at that edge. As a Lead Power Electronics Engineer within GE Vernova's Power Conversion & Storage business in Rugby, you will shape the design and development of next-generation megawatt (MW)-scale power electronics converter systems. From marine and naval platforms to energy and industrial applications, your work will directly influence products deployed across some of the world's most demanding environments.

This is a senior individual contributor role for an engineer who wants deep technical ownership — and the scope to pursue it.

Key Responsibilities
  • Design and deliver converter solutions— specify, design, and document power electronics converter systems to meet complex application requirements, including circuit design, snubber design, gating electronics, and thermal design across a range of semiconductor device technologies (Diodes, Thyristors, IGBTs (Insulated-Gate Bipolar Transistors), IGCTs (Integrated Gate-Commutated Thyristors), MOSFETs (Metal-Oxide-Semiconductor Field-Effect Transistors), SiC (Silicon Carbide), and GaN (Gallium Nitride)).
  • Model, simulate, and analyse— lead modelling and simulation of power electronic converter systems using tools such as MATLAB/Simulink, PLECS, PSpice, Mathcad, and CFD (Computational Fluid Dynamics), including thermal studies, EMC (Electromagnetic Compatibility), harmonic analysis, and performance optimisation.
  • Verify and validate— lead verification, validation, and testing of low voltage and medium voltage power electronic systems, ensuring designs comply with relevant health and safety standards, international regulations, and class society rules.
  • Provide cross-functional technical support— collaborate with tendering, test, and commissioning teams, and liaise with customers, suppliers, and subcontractors to deliver against project quality, cost, and schedule targets.
  • Advance engineering practice— apply and develop engineering standards, design practices, and analytical tools that raise the bar for MW-scale converter system engineering across the team.
About You

You are an experienced power electronics engineer with strong domain knowledge of MW-scale converter systems and a track record of delivering complex technical solutions from specification through to validation.

Required

  • Degree (BEng, MEng or PhD) in Power Electronics, Electrical Engineering, or a closely related discipline — a formal qualification is advantageous, but we are most interested in your total experience and professional achievements.
  • Strong experience in power electronics converter design, including semiconductor device knowledge and associated gating electronics, snubber circuits, and thermal design.
  • Skilled in power electronics simulation and design tools such as MATLAB/Simulink, PLECS, Mathcad, or equivalent.
  • Eligible to obtain UK Security Clearance (SC).
  • Willingness to travel within the UK and internationally on a short‑term basis.

Preferred

  • Knowledge of power electronics converter control systems and electrical machine control methods.
  • Experience with SAP and Teamcenter PLM (Product Lifecycle Management) systems.
  • Full UK driving licence.
